Understanding What a 3 Inch Exhaust Coupler Is

First, it’s essential to know that a 3 inch exhaust coupler is a connector designed to join two sections of exhaust pipes that are 3 inches in diameter. It helps ensure a secure and leak-free connection, which is crucial for optimal exhaust flow and performance.

Material Matters: Stainless Steel vs. Aluminized Steel

From my experience, the material of the coupler makes a big difference. Stainless steel couplers resist rust and corrosion better, making them ideal if you want something long-lasting, especially in humid or salty environments. Aluminized steel couplers are usually cheaper but may not last as long if exposed to harsh conditions.

Type of Coupler: Clamp-On vs. Weld-On

I had to decide between clamp-on and weld-on couplers. Clamp-on couplers are easier to install since they don’t require welding tools or skills, making them perfect for quick fixes or DIY projects. Weld-on couplers provide a more permanent and secure connection but need professional welding, which might be an extra cost and effort.

Fit and Compatibility

Ensuring the coupler fits perfectly with your existing exhaust pipes is crucial. I measured my pipes carefully to confirm the 3 inch diameter and checked the wall thickness compatibility. Some couplers are designed for specific pipe thicknesses, so double-checking these details saved me from buying the wrong size.

Heat Resistance and Durability

Since exhaust systems get very hot, I looked for couplers that can withstand high temperatures without deforming or losing strength. Stainless steel usually scores high here. Also, durability ensures the coupler won’t crack or fail under continuous heat cycles.

Ease of Installation

I considered how easy it would be to install the coupler myself. Clamp-on types with pre-installed clamps or bolts made the process faster and less stressful. If you’re not comfortable welding, a clamp-on coupler is usually the best choice.
